Lesbian teenager parodies Westboro Baptist Church video

Rebecca Anderson, a 16 year-old lesbian teenager from Edinburgh, was so infuriated by Westboro Baptist Church’s homophobic parody of Panic! At The Disco’s ‘Write Sins Not Tragedies’ that she felt moved to make her own parody of their parody, entitled ‘Your Beliefs Are A Lie What A Tragedy’.

Rebecca’s video, can be found on Youtube and has already been viewed over 8,000 times, invites the world to recognise the hypocrisy and hatred of Westboro Baptist Church, best known for its extreme ideologies, especially those against gay people, who used homophobic and offensive language in their parody of the Panic at the Disco song, which they named ‘You Love Is Sin What A Tragedy’.

Rebecca’s mum was so proud of her daughter, she circulated the video link to the media and is urging all LGBT people to view it.
